This adds a new context.Context argument to the Backend.StateMgr method, updates all of the implementations to match, and then updates all of the callers to pass in a context. A small number of callers don't yet have context plumbed to them so those use context.TODO() as a placeholder for now, so we can more easily find and fix them in later commits once we have contexts more thoroughly plumbed.
